yea its funny about fakes even sony have trouble telling and they slip into the supply chain way to easy
the first packing rule is the seals real sticks have a square seal which has been heat sealed and fakes have round one that just push together. and the hologram as you can see on the left should be straight because a machine sticks it on (of course it could be an error) but basing it on them
the best way to tell is the serial number of the stick Ebay has a list somewhere…
also the manual should be in 17 (i think) different languages and folded 20 times…
